Ratking at the Deaf Institute

New York hip-hop group Ratking, consist of two MCs, Wiki and Hak, and a producer, Sporting Life. Formed in 2011, to date they have released one EP, Wiki93 (2012), and two albums, So It Goes (2014), and 700 Fill (2015). Their music has been described… Read more »

Peanut Butter Wolf at Sound Control

Chris Manak – AKA Peanut Butter Wolf – started up his own label Stones Throw Records in 1996, releasing a string of acclaimed albums including his own My Vinyl Weighs A Ton, MF Doom’s Madvillain and J Dilla’s Donuts. On Monday the 24th of August,… Read more »
